Episodes

Episode 1 Aired Feb 26, 2024 The Blind Auditions Premiere The competition is fierce as Dan + Shay claim their double chair; alongside returning coaches Chance the Rapper, John Legend and Reba McEntire, they all vie to discover and coach the next singing phenomenon. Details Episode 2 Aired Feb 27, 2024 The Blind Auditions, Part 2 Coaches Chance the Rapper, Dan + Shay, John Legend and Reba McEntire all vie to discover and coach the next singing phenomenon on the second night of blind auditions. Details Episode 3 Aired Mar 4, 2024 The Blind Auditions, Part 3 Coaches Chance the Rapper, Dan + Shay, John Legend and Reba McEntire all vie to discover and coach the next singing phenomenon on the third night of blind auditions. Details Episode 4 Aired Mar 5, 2024 The Blind Auditions, Part 4 Coaches Chance the Rapper, Dan + Shay, John Legend and Reba McEntire all vie to discover and coach the next singing phenomenon on the fourth night of blind auditions. Details Episode 5 Aired Mar 11, 2024 The Blind Auditions, Part 5 Coaches Chance the Rapper, Dan + Shay, John Legend and Reba McEntire all vie to discover and coach the next singing phenomenon on the fifth night of blind auditions. Details Episode 6 Aired Mar 12, 2024 The Blind Auditions, Part 6 Coaches Chance the Rapper, Dan + Shay, John Legend and Reba McEntire all vie to discover and coach the next singing phenomenon on the sixth and final night of blind auditions. Details Episode 7 Aired Mar 18, 2024 The Battles Premiere The battle rounds begin as Chance the Rapper, Dan + Shay, John Legend and Reba McEntire prepare their artists in hopes of advancing to the knockouts; each coach has one steal and one playoff pass, which sends an artist straight to the playoffs. Details Episode 8 Aired Mar 19, 2024 The Battles Part 2 The battle rounds continue as Chance the Rapper, Dan + Shay, John Legend and Reba McEntire prepare their artists in hopes of advancing to the knockouts; each coach has one steal and one playoff pass, which sends an artist straight to the playoffs. Details Episode 9 Aired Mar 25, 2024 The Battles Part 3 The battle rounds continue as Chance the Rapper, Dan + Shay, John Legend and Reba McEntire prepare their artists in hopes of advancing to the knockouts; each coach has one steal and one playoff pass, which sends an artist straight to the playoffs. Details Episode 10 Aired Mar 26, 2024 The Battles Part 4 The battle rounds end as Chance the Rapper, Dan + Shay, John Legend and Reba McEntire prepare their artists in hopes of advancing to the knockouts; each coach has one steal and one playoff pass, which sends an artist straight to the playoffs. Details Episode 11 Aired Apr 1, 2024 Best of Blinds & Battles The season's best moments from the blind auditions through the battle rounds are shared from the coaches' perspectives, along with a look at never-before-seen footage of the coaches and a sneak peek at the upcoming knockouts with the mega mentor. Details Episode 12 Aired Apr 8, 2024 The Knockouts Premiere Country powerhouse Keith Urban is enlisted as mega mentor to help prepare the artists for the knockouts; the coaches pair two artists to perform solo against each other, then select a winner to move on to the playoffs; each coach has one steal. Details Episode 13 Aired Apr 15, 2024 The Knockouts Country powerhouse Keith Urban serves as mega mentor to help prepare the artists for the knockouts; the coaches pair two artists to perform solo against each other, then select a winner to move on to the playoffs; each coach has one steal. Details Episode 14 Aired Apr 22, 2024 The Playoffs Premiere Coaches John Legend and Dan + Shay enlist the help of superstar mentors as their remaining artists hold nothing back during the playoffs; tough decisions are made as each coach can only advance three artists to the live shows. Details Episode 15 Aired Apr 29, 2024 The Playoffs, Part 2 Coaches Reba McEntire and Chance the Rapper enlist the help of superstar mentors as their remaining artists hold nothing back during the playoffs; tough decisions are made as each coach can only advance three artists to the live shows. Details Episode 16 Aired May 6, 2024 Live Top 12 Performances The top 12 artists perform live for the first time in front of coaches Chance the Rapper, Dan + Shay, John Legend and Reba McEntire for their spot in the live semi-final; viewers will have the chance to vote for their favorite artist overnight. Details Episode 17 Aired May 7, 2024 Live Top 12 Results The voting results from the top 12 live performances are revealed; eight artists are voted through, and four perform for the instant save; the stakes are high, as only nine artists can continue on to the live semi-final. Details Episode 18 Aired May 13, 2024 Live Semi-Final Performances The top nine artists perform hometown dedications in front of coaches Chance the Rapper, Dan + Shay, John Legend and Reba McEntire for their chance at a spot in the live finale; viewers have the chance to vote for their favorite artist overnight. Details Episode 19 Aired May 14, 2024 Live Semi-Final Results The voting results from the top nine live performances are revealed; four artists are voted through, and five perform for the instant save; the stakes are high as only five artists make it to the live finale to compete for the title. Details Episode 20 Aired May 20, 2024 Live Finale The top five artists perform a ballad and an up-tempo song in front of coaches Chance the Rapper, Dan + Shay, John Legend and Reba McEntire to compete for the title of The Voice; viewers have the chance to vote for their favorite artist overnight.
